Cayden Xavier Lee (born November 17, 2004) is an American college football wide receiver for the Missouri Tigers. He previously played for the Ole Miss Rebels.
Early life
[edit]Lee attended Kennesaw Mountain High School in Kennesaw, Georgia. As a senior, he totaled 74 receptions for 1,101 yards and 13 touchdowns, before committing to play college football at the University of Mississippi.[1]
College career
[edit]In the first game of his collegiate career against Mercer, Lee hauled in a 34-yard touchdown pass from Spencer Sanders.[2] He made his first career start in the 2023 Peach Bowl against Penn State, finishing with three catches for 29 yards.[3] Lee finished his freshman season totaling five receptions for 114 yards and two touchdowns.[4] His production increased during his sophomore season, catching five passes for 127 yards against Arkansas.[5] Lee ended the 2024 season recording 57 catches for 874 yards and two touchdowns.[6] He entered his junior season as the Rebels' leading returning receiver.[7][8] Lee finished the 2025 season catching 44 passes for 635 yards and three touchdowns.[9] On January 17, 2026, he entered the transfer portal.[10]
